“Ovenly Expands to Greenpoint”

The folks at Ovenly, popular makers of snacks and sweets, sent over word that they plan to open shop in Greenpoint, Brooklyn, in March. We've been fans of theirs since we tried them at Smorgasburg this summer and love their take on savory-singed sweets. Spicy bacon caramel corn? Apricot thyme scones? Candied ginger chocolate cookies? Yes, please! 

Owners Agatha Kulaga and Erin Patinkin will bring their fresh ingredients — think aromatic ground spices, sweet vanilla beans, quality chocolates — to this new space, which has a kitchen in one part and a hybrid retail and café space in the other, designed by artist Brady Dollarhide and brothers Oliver and Evan Haslegrave of hOmE. They’ll run it as part test kitchen and storefront for their snack experiments.

On an interesting note, they also provide ferry commuters with grab-and-go breakfast and lunch boxes. Classes and small events are slated to take place at their brick-and-mortar location down the road. Feel free to share your two cents about these treats!

Ovenly will be located at 31 Greenpoint Avenue, www.ovenlynyc.com
